Three families of phosphorus-containing dendrimers having chiral ferrocenic subunitsprecisely placed at one individual shell within their skeleton are synthesized. The influenceof the progressive "burying" of the chiral ferrocene derivatives upon their electrochemicaland chiroptical properties is reported. It is shown that both properties depend mainly onthe chemical environment of the chiral organometallic centers. However, they differ in thesensitivity to the "burying"; the chiroptical properties do not appear to be sensitive to wherethe chiral units are positioned within the dendrimer, whereas the electrochemical propertiesare.
